I have project where I would like to use the SX20 codec, due to it being having multisite at an affordable price. But locating the codec and camera together is not an option for this installation. So I need to extend the camera cable,Picture attached.
I am thinking of ordering the following gear: SX20 Codec,
PrecisionHD Camera 1080P12x (not the new SX20 camera), Picture attached.
Power supply PSU-CAM-V and cat6 shielded POE injector camera extension kit CAB-PHD-EXTR
My theory here is to inject power via the camera's power supply over the Cat6 cable with the POE unit on it, to enable a longer control cable run. Then use a Kramer PT10Hxl HDMI extender to handle the video signal.
Would this work? Or does anyone know of a CISCO endorsed method/manual on how exactly to do this
